Chandox SE series chucks from LMC Workholding are suited for holding workpieces in gaging and metrology applications. They feature steel bodies and a knob that is rotated directly for gripping and loosening without the need for a handle. Reversible jaws are designed to grip a variety of sizes more conveniently. A 2" chuck can grip workpieces as small as 0.8 mm.
